halting-problem

    0

    1답변

    : def X(R: Any): Any = X(R) 그러나 컴파일 시간에 simmilar 일을 할 수 없습니다 scala> type X[R] = X[R] <console>:11: error: illegal cyclic reference involving type X type X[R] = X[R] ^ 는 무한 루프/재귀 보호처럼

    3

    2답변

    모든 agda 프로그램이 종료되는 곳이 몇 곳 있습니다. 그러나 다음과 같은 함수를 만들 수 있습니다 : stall : ∀ n → ℕ stall 0 = 0 stall x = stall x 구문 형광펜은 좋아하지 않지만 컴파일 오류가 없습니다. stall 0의 정규형을 계산하면 0이됩니다. stall 1의 결과를 계산하면 Emacs가 멈추지 않는 루프

    1

    1답변

    어셈블리에서 자체 BF 인터프리터로 작성했으며 현재 어셈블리 코드로 컴파일하는 Java에서 BF 컴파일러를 작성하고 있습니다. 메모리 셀 배열이 범위를 벗어난 경우 감지 된 조금 좋은 기능을 구현하고 싶습니다. 배열의 일반적인 제한 사항은 인덱스를 [0, 30000)으로 설정하는 것입니다. 그렇지 않으면 [0, inf)도 일반적으로 사용됩니다. 또 다른 옵

    0

    1답변

    나는 질문에 붙어있어 해결책을위한 약간의 지침을 원합니다. - 프로그램 문제 - 프로그램이 중단되는 가능한 입력의 수는 프로그램이 '이긴 것보다 더 큰 않습니다 입력 : 나는 다음 문제가 결정 불가능 것을 증명해야 멈춰? (입력이 짝수 인 경우) 모든 짝수에 대해 중단되고, 모든 홀수에 대해 무한 루프로 이동하여 입력으로 프로그램을 실행하는 감소를 만들려고

    0

    1답변

    다음은 유물 계산을위한 유성 애플리케이션의 일부 코드 (관련 데이터 포함)의 본질입니다. Meteor.call('projects.increment',1)가 호출되는 경우 각각의 카운트가 다른 링크로 // The counting and linking code. Meteor.methods({ 'counts.increment'(countId) {

    1

    1답변

    중단 문제는 한 프로그램에서 다른 프로그램의 출력을 예측할 수 없거나 프로그램이 종료 될지 여부를 나타냅니다. 내 생각에 ... 휴리스틱 기반 스캐너는 주어진 실행 가능 프로그램의 지침이 "바이러스와 유사한"방식으로 프로그램이 수행 할 작업을 예측하는 것을 완전히 포함하는지 여부를 어떻게 결정합니까?

    1

    1답변

    나는 최근에 문제를 모순적인 증거를 찾아 냈습니다. 증명에서 우리는 튜링 기계에 프로그램 사본과 입력 사본을 입력하여 해당 프로그램이 입력에서 중단되는지 여부를 결정해야합니다. 모순에서 왜 프로그램과 입력으로 프로그램이되어야합니까? 혼란 스러울 경우 미안 해요. 컴퓨터에 프로그램과 임의의 입력을 간단하게 공급할 수 있으며 동일한 결론을 내릴 수 있습니다.

    0

    1답변

    그것은 충분히 간단한 함수를 들어, 가능한 입력을 중단 할 경우 알 수 있습니다 function(boolean input){ while(input){ } } 을 가정 해 봅시다 나의 이해이다. 위의 함수는 false에 대해 종료되고 true. It's only impossible to solve the halting problem f

    0

    1답변

    나는 TM = DFA는 정지에서 감소를 사용하여 결정 불가능하다는 것을 증명하고있다 이론적으로 Turing Machine은 계산 가능한 모든 기능을 캡처하고 DFA는 상수로 계산할 수있는 기능 만 캡처한다는 것을 이해합니다. 공간 따라서 TM = DFA는 결정 불가능하다. 여기 내 단계는 : 결정하는 R L (M) = L (D)를 가정 EQ_DM = {[D

    1

    1답변

    예를 들어,이 튜링 기계 인 H는 프로그램과 입력이 중단되는지 여부를 알려줍니다. 자체적으로 H를 호출한다고 가정 해 봅시다. 답변을 주어야합니다. 따라서 "멈추지 않는다"라는 문구를 인쇄한다면 기술적으로 문구를 인쇄하지 않는 것이 아닌가? 아니면 항상 이론 상으로는 "멈추지 않을 것"이라고 인쇄 할 것인가? 나는 H를 순전히 부정적으로 부르지 않고, 부정